I received this Thomas Kincade stamp this yesterday from my secret sister and just had to ink it up last night. Stamped in pallet noir and colored with WWC and an aquapainter. Added old scrapbook picture "holders" to frame it with before layering on black paper. Tried to make it look like a painting hanging on a wall, but couldn't get it to look right, so I added the two extra gold brads at the top and purple wire on the "painting" to fill in the holes I had added. Looks much better now.
